Michael: The King of Pop Biopic - Breaking Records and Redefining Music-Focused Films

The highly anticipated film "Michael," featuring Jaafar Jackson and directed by Antoine Fuqua, has broken records with over 116 million trailer views in just 24 hours. The biopic showcases the life of the iconic "King of Pop," Michael Jackson, on the silver screen. This achievement marks a significant milestone in the history of music-focused film trailers, surpassing previous records set by other notable biopics and Lionsgate's film catalog.

Directed by Antoine Fuqua, known for his work on "Training Day," "Michael" stars Jaafar Jackson, the real-life nephew of Michael Jackson, in his debut role as his legendary uncle. The cast also includes Colman Domingo, Nia Long, Laura Harrier, and Larenz Tate. The film is scheduled for release in theaters and IMAX on April 24, 2026, with the possibility of expanding into multiple parts to fully capture the essence of Michael Jackson's life.

Jaafar Jackson expressed his gratitude and excitement for portraying his uncle on screen, sharing glimpses of the film's production on social media. The official synopsis of "Michael" promises to delve into Michael Jackson's life beyond his music, tracing his journey from the Jackson Five to becoming a global entertainment icon. The film aims to provide audiences with a comprehensive look at both the public successes and personal challenges faced by Michael Jackson, offering a unique perspective on the legendary artist.

Lionsgate executives are impressed with the initial director's cut of the film, considering the potential for expanding the project into multiple installments. While plans for a second film are not yet confirmed, the studio is actively working on ensuring that audiences can experience more of Michael Jackson's story following the release of the first film.
